Shinden
Shinden is a locality in Kurihara Shi, Miyagi. Shinden is situated nearby to the locality Kurikoma-monji, as well as near Yamaguchi.Places of Interest
Highlights include Aratozawa Dam.
Aratozawa Dam
Dam
Photo: 河川一等兵, Public domain.
Aratozawa Dam is a dam in Kurihara, Miyagi Prefecture, Japan, completed in 1998. Aratozawa Dam is situated 2½ km northwest of Shinden.
